How it works

Three steps. About two minutes.

No hardware to order, no battery to charge, no pairing.

01

Make a tag

Create a digital tag and it's live instantly. Print it, engrave it, stick it on — the design and the placement are yours.

02

Someone scans it

Any phone camera opens your tag's page in a browser. The finder installs nothing and signs up for nothing.

03

You hear about it

An alert lands in the app, on WhatsApp, in Slack or on your own webhook — with the message and where it came from.

Privacy

Reachable. Not exposed.

A finder gets everything they need to return your thing, and nothing they could use to find you. Every message routes through MyTags.

What the finder sees

  • What the item is, and any note you left for them
  • A message box that reaches you immediately
  • Anything you chose to publish — a reward, an instruction, a document

What never leaves your account

  • Your phone number and your email address
  • Your name, your address, your home
  • Private notes, invoices and warranties you keep on the item

Questions

Before you sign up

Do I have to buy anything?

No. Create a digital tag, print or engrave it yourself, and it works the second it's scanned. Physical tags are an option, not a requirement.

Does the finder need the app?

No. Any phone camera opens the tag's page in a browser. They can message you without downloading or signing up for anything.

Is this GPS tracking?

No — and that's the point. There's no radio and no battery, so a tag costs nothing to run and never reports on you. It speaks only when a person scans it.

What can a stranger learn about me?

Only what you publish on the tag. Messages route through MyTags, so your number and email are never revealed — in either direction.

Can I keep documents with an item?

Yes. Invoices, warranties, service notes and reminders live with the tag — private by default, published only if you say so.
